"I Worship You" by The Little Willies, released in 2006, is a #Country song that expresses deep admiration and love for someone special. The lyrics convey devotion and longing, highlighting themes of worship and idealization in relationships. The song features a blend of traditional country instrumentation with a laid-back vibe, showcasing the band's unique sound. Its heartfelt sentiment resonates with listeners, contributing to its appeal in the Americana music scene.
